Personality Trait
A characteristic way an individual thinks, feels, and behaves, shaping their personality.
Conscientiousness
A personality trait marked by organization, dependability, and a strong sense of duty.
Humanism
A philosophical and ethical stance that emphasizes the value and agency of human beings, individually and collectively.
Abraham Maslow
An American psychologist known for creating Maslow's hierarchy of needs, a theory in psychology regarding human motivation.
